Kraken is contemplating an initial public offering (IPO) as early as the first quarter of 2026, although the company may still alter its plans. Bloomberg initially reported this development, citing sources familiar with the situation.

“We’ve recently shared our 2024 financial highlights to increase transparency about our business. This builds on our initial efforts as the first to publish proof of reserves, and transparency will remain a priority for us moving forward,” a Kraken spokesperson said. “We’ll consider entering public markets when it aligns with the interests of our clients, partners, and shareholders.”

Kraken, which generated over $1.5 billion in revenue in 2024, has been contemplating a public listing since at least 2021. The company also explored raising over $100 million in a pre-IPO funding round during mid-2024.

Kraken is now among several crypto firms, including Gemini and eToro, considering public listings under a more crypto-friendly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C).
